U.K. Insolvencies Set To Soar In ‘09 February 06, 2009



—Hugh Leask

Corporate insolvencies in the U.K. are expected to hit 5,000 by the end of the year, according to research from accountancy firm KPMG. The number is up from 3,225 insolvencies seen in 2008 and 2,230 in 2007.
